> Strongly opinion-flavoured answer:
> Never ever write code w/o namespace.
>
> Even scripts gain advantages if you
> provide an entry point in a namespace:
>
> - easier debugging since loading doesn't
>  fire off the script's actions
> - multiple entry points
> - easier re-use of the scripts functionality
>  as a library
>

Many +1 as well : if you start using an IDE (or if you care that some of
your users do), then chances are the IDE will try to periodically reload the
namespaces (event based or cron-like based), and having "scripts" firing
actions on load is a big no no for using those IDEs then :-(
